A leading engineering consultancy is seeking a Project Engineer – Wastewater to support the delivery of wastewater infrastructure projects across Ireland. The role involves preparing design reports, managing contracts, and ensuring compliance with regulations.
Candidates should have 5+ years of experience in wastewater engineering and a relevant Bachelor's degree. This full-time position offers opportunities for international projects and is ideal for those passionate about sustainable engineering solutions.
